Synonym | Coluber vittacaudatus BLYTH 1854: 740 Coluber vittacaudatus — DAS et al. 1998 Coluber vittacaudatus — DAS 2003 Argyrogena vittacaudata — WALLACH et al. 2014: 54 Platyceps vittacaudatus — DEEPAK et al. 2021 (by implication) |
Distribution | India (Darjeeling, West Bengal) Type locality: from "vicinity of Darjiling" (= Darjeeling, 27° 02'N; 88° 16'E; West Bengal State, eastern India). Known only from the type locality. |
Reproduction | oviparous |
Types | Holotype: lost (fide Das et al., 1998) |

Comment | Status: unclear. The identity of Coluber vittacaudatus Blyth remains questionable fide Deepak et al. 2021 who synonymize Argyrogena with Platyceps. |
Etymology | Named after “vittacaudatus” = Latin for striped tail. |
